1. Assess Your Syllabus: Break It Down

The first step to creating a successful study schedule is knowing exactly what you need to cover. The A-Level Physics syllabus may look like a big hill to climb, but it can be broken down into smaller chunks to make it more manageable.

  • List all the topics: First of all, go through your syllabus and make a list of the chapters and subtopics. Whether it’s Mechanics, Electricity, or Particle Physics, you better know it so that you can plan better.
  • Prioritise topics based on weight: In A-level Physics, there are few topics having more weight in the exam. For instance, Mechanics is often the basis for many questions. Find the high-weight topics and allot them more time in your schedule.

Defining what exactly needs to be covered allows you to feel like everything is more under control and that you are less likely to have overlooked something important.

3. Create a Realistic Timetable; Don’t Overdo It

A study schedule is meant to guide you, not stress you out. You may be tempted to become very ambitious and pack your day full of hours studying, but that is not sustainable. Remember, the goal is to be consistent, not to burn out.

  • Set manageable daily goals: Saying, “I will study physics for 6 hours today,” is very vague and not doable in the beginning. Try saying, “I will revise mechanics for an hour, solve some past paper questions in the next, then read notes of quantum phenomena for half an hour.”
  • Use the Pomodoro Technique: Study for 25 minutes, then take a break for 5 minutes. You then take a longer break after four sessions. This will keep your mental energy high and focused, preventing that dreaded mental fatigue.
  • Account for school and personal time: You likely have school, extracurriculars, or part-time work. Be realistic about the time you have, and make sure to schedule breaks and personal time. Overloading your schedule leads to burnout, and that’s the last thing you want before your A-Levels.

A realistic study schedule is one you will stick with, but always remember that consistency beats cramming any day.

4. Mix Up Your Study Techniques

Physics is not a subject that can be mastered by reading textbooks alone. It requires a blend of understanding theory, practising problems, and applying concepts. Mixing up your study methods keeps things interesting and effective!

  • Active Learning: Sum up what you learned in your own words instead of just reading the notes passively. It helps reinforce the concepts.
  • Past papers are gold: Always practise past papers as they are gold. The more you see these types of questions, the more confident you will be when taking the exam. Try and do one past paper per week during the months before your exam.
  • Use visual aids: Physics often involves understanding abstract concepts. Diagrams, graphs, and videos can help you visualise how systems work, like how forces act on a moving object or how waves interact. YouTube is filled with excellent physics tutorials tailored to A-Level content.
  • Teach someone else: There is no better way of testing your understanding than teaching a topic to someone else. The fact that, if you are able to explain it, you have understood the concept. If not, then you should revisit the material.

By switching between reading, practising, and teaching, you ensure that you’re not only covering material but mastering it.

6. Incorporate Time for Revision and Mock Tests

As exam day gets closer, revision and mock tests become increasingly important. Reviewing old material and simulating exam conditions are vital steps in securing that top grade.

  • Revision blocks As you get closer to the exam season, spend additional time on revision. Review your notes, pay attention to weak areas, and go over those high-weight topics you know will be on the exam.
  • Take full-length mock exams: Simulate real exam conditions by writing full-length mock tests. Time yourself, follow the same format as the actual A-Level exam, and get used to the pressure of performing under timed conditions. It will help you build confidence in giving exams and manage time effectively on given exam days.

A well-planned revision phase can convert all those hours of hard work into top-tier results.
